Elo’s Former PE Head Joins Coda Alternatives

Stockholm (HedgeNordic) – Karita Meling, Elo’s former Head of Private Equity, is joining Finnish fundraising advisory Coda Alternatives as Senior Advisor. She served as Elo’s Head of Private Equity since Elo was born from the merger of Pension Fennia and LocalTapiola in 2014 through the end of 2022.

“I intended to take a break from business, but the new year has brought some exciting board and advisory roles,” says Karita Meling on LinkedIn. “Being Senior Advisor at Coda Alternatives was difficult to pass.” Before Elo’s formation in 2014, Meling worked at Tapiola Pension for about 12 years, first as head of direct equity investments and then as head of real estate and private equity investments. She also worked in equity research for about seven years at Handelsbanken Capital Markets.

“Karita Meling joins Coda Alternatives as Senior Advisor strengthening Coda’s strategic private market expertise and global manager network,” announces Coda Alternatives, a Helsinki-based fundraising advisory focused on alternative asset classes. The firm focuses on helping private market managers enhance their presence in the Nordic region by connecting them with local institutional investors and family offices.

“I am absolutely delighted to have somebody like Karita on board,” comments Kimmo Eloranta, the founder of Coda Alternatives. “I believe her unique private market experience and global contact network will help Coda to serve the market even better,” he continues. “It has been great to notice that we share the same values and approach, clearly focusing on partnering with top-quality managers.”
